Ok, I finally came around testing the QA401H based web app.

Checking with 'lsusb' the QA401 is discovered correctly.

Unfortunately i get an Error concerning libusb-1.0 when starting the QA401H server application. Please refer to screenshot attached. The machine is running xubuntu 20.04LTS.

Any ideas?

Type the following command in a shell:
Code:
sudo dpkg -l|grep libusb

This will tell you if it's installed.

If it's installed you should see something similar to below (this is from my Debian 10 system)

Code:
ii  libusb-0.1-4:amd64                2:0.1.12-32                         amd64        userspace USB programming library
ii  libusb-1.0-0:amd64                2:1.0.22-2                          amd64        userspace USB programming library

If it's installed then you can find it's location with
Code:
sudo dpkg -L <library name>

In my case, the library is in '/lib/x86_64-linux-gnu/libusb-0.1.so.4'

Thank you very much for your support. Certainly, libsub was installed before i tried launching the QA401H application. As stated in the QA401H manual.

The library resides in "/lib/x86_64-linux-gnu/" on my machine. Adding this path to "/etc/ld.so.conf" with a subsequent "sudo ldconfig" did not help.
 
So it's the library name that's the issue.

As per the page mentioned in the post above - this should fix it.

Code:
cd /lib/x86_64-linux-gnu
sudo ln -s libusb-1.0.so.0 libusb-1.0.so

This is creating a symbolic link to libusb-1.0.so.0.1.0

The symbolic link is called libusb-1.0.so.0 - and it is this library that the software is addressing.
 
Yes, the symlink did fix it. Now the library is recognized by the dotnet framework and the QA401H is able to communicate with the hardware!

Unfortunately USB cables do vary. You need a cable with low DCR in its power wires. It's a common place for cost savings. The data link pair are less of an issue. I went through about 15 cables sorting them on a 192 KHz distortion loopback and about 1/2 passed. The easiest way to see potential is large diameter and stiff. Also an external hub with a separate power supply helps.
